Recovering Damages After an accident
When you suffer an injury in a car accident and are injured, you could be eligible to receive financial compensation for the losses. You can recover economic damages, which could include medical bills, future health costs and the loss of wages due to the absence of work. Additionally, you can recover non-economic damages that compensate you for the pain and suffering.
A New York truck accident attorney can help you understand the legal framework that assigns responsibility for an accident, as well as the different kinds of damages. For example, if the driver was working at the time of the crash and acted in violation of their employer's standard of care, they could be found to be liable under a legal doctrine known as respondeat superior. Truck drivers are usually employed by large transportation companies. These employers have extensive insurance policies that cover their employees' actions.

Also, you could be entitled to punitive damages in certain circumstances. These are intended to punish and discourage the party at fault from engaging in similar reckless behavior in the future. They are rare but they could happen in the event that the truck driver at fault was grossly negligent or reckless.

If you do not have health insurance through your private company medical payments coverage might be covered under your car policy to pay for the medical bills. However should this coverage be exhausted and medical bills are paid by your private health insurance or Medicare, these bills will have to be paid with any money that is derived from a settlement or a verdict. Private health insurers, Medicare and ERISA plans all have a legal right to reimburse this amount and auto insurance companies usually will not distribute settlement checks until the reimbursement is made.
